Places of Learning


Book Description
Places of Learning was written by Richard Reid. Places of Learning was published by Mills & Boon. Subjects of Places of Learning include Architecture & buildings, Buildings, Juvenile Nonfiction / Architecture, Learned institutions and societies, Outlines, syllabi, etc, Reference & Home Learning, and The built environment.
